How to Purchase Pain Medication in Spain
Purchasing pain medication in Spain can vary depending on whether the medication is readily available over the counter or requires a prescription.
Buying Over-the-Counter Medications
Drug stores: All towns in Spain have drug stores (farmacias) that are permitted to sell OTC medications. Try to find a green cross sign to identify a drug store.
Schedule: Common OTC medications like Paracetamol, Ibuprofen, and Aspirin can be found without a prescription. However, it's suggested to consult with the pharmacist about the appropriate dosage and any possible interactions with other medications you may be taking.
Language Barrier: While many pharmacists in larger cities speak English, having a translation app or a list of medications in Spanish can be useful.
Buying Prescription Medications
Consult a Doctor: To obtain prescription medications, one should initially visit a health care professional. If you are a traveler, you might require to check out a private clinic to get a prescription.
National Health System: Residents covered by the Spanish health system can acquire medications at a minimized expense. It's necessary to bring your health care card (tarjeta sanitaria) to access these benefits.
Drug store Visit: Once you have a prescription, take it to any drug store. Drug stores in Spain are equipped to manage prescriptions from other EU nations, but it's a good idea to contact the pharmacist concerning specific policies.

FAQs About Buying Pain Medication in Spain
Q1: Can I buy prescription medication without a prescription in Spain?
A1: No, prescription medications can not be purchased without a valid prescription from a qualified healthcare expert in Spain.
Q2: Are there any specific pain medications that are not readily available in Spain?

Q3: What should I do if I lack my pain medication while in Spain?
A3: Visit a local pharmacy and seek advice from with the pharmacist. If you have a prescription, you can get a refill. If not, you may need to seek advice from a local medical professional.
Q4: Do drug stores in Spain accept health insurance coverage for prescription medications?
A4: Yes, if you have Spanish medical insurance, you can obtain prescription medications at a decreased cost, offered you have your health card.
Q5: Is it safe to buy medications from online pharmacies in Spain?
A5: Caution is recommended when buying medications online. Guarantee that the online pharmacy is certified and compliant with EU guidelines. It is best to stick with respectable pharmacies.
